You've probably seen those shiny solar panels on rooftops feeding clean energy back to the grid. But here's the kicker - on grid inverters alone leave homes completely vulnerable during outages. When Texas froze in 2021 or California fires hit last summer, millions discovered their solar arrays became expensive lawn ornaments when the grid failed.
